# API Reference: Ed25519 Digital Signature Agent
|
|
|
|
## Dependencies
|
|
|
|
| Library | Version | Purpose |
|
|
|---------|---------|---------|
|
|
| cryptography | >=41.0 | Ed25519 key generation, signing, verification |

## Functions
|
|
|
|
### `generate_keypair(output_dir, key_name) -> dict`
|
|
`Ed25519PrivateKey.generate()`, serializes with `private_bytes(PEM, PKCS8, NoEncryption)` and `public_bytes(PEM, SubjectPublicKeyInfo)`.
|
|
|
|
### `sign_message(private_key_path, message) -> dict`
|
|
Loads key via `load_pem_private_key()`, calls `key.sign(message)`. Returns base64 and hex signature.
|
|
|
|
### `sign_file(private_key_path, file_path) -> dict`
|
|
Signs file contents, writes `.ed25519.sig` JSON containing signature, hash, timestamp.
|
|
|
|
### `verify_message(public_key_path, message, signature_b64) -> dict`
|
|
Calls `key.verify(signature, message)`. Catches `InvalidSignature`.
|
|
|
|
### `verify_file(public_key_path, file_path, sig_path) -> dict`
|
|
Verifies file against `.ed25519.sig` JSON, checks hash match.
|
|
|
|
## cryptography API
|
|
|
|
| Method | Purpose |
|
|
|--------|---------|
|
|
| `Ed25519PrivateKey.generate()` | Generate 32-byte private key |
|
|
| `private_key.sign(data)` | Create 64-byte signature |
|
|
| `public_key.verify(signature, data)` | Verify signature |
|
|
| `load_pem_private_key(data, password)` | Load PEM key |
